Output 5ec28f13b6e4f6be2e462b38d6cad4ae56578776469e547759805fbae665ac61:8

value
30890309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3fd5ddb7b9cb6118066ab9ff669634bf4a8be8d OP_EQUAL
address
MNrFtvMHwPR9nMKaPaGytQAMkBBtN442xg
transaction
5ec28f13b6e4f6be2e462b38d6cad4ae56578776469e547759805fbae665ac61
spent
true